NVIDIA says: no more "brute force every pixel" of video understanding.
AutoGaze- identifies and removes redundant video patches before they enter a Vision Transformer.
Now we can processes 4K long-video in real-time.
Works with SigLIP2 and NVILA.

GN⁺: NIST(미국 국립표준기술연구소), 특정 비밀번호 문자 구성 요구 금지 https://t.co/pQpEfMlVBE
- NIST는 "다양한 문자 스타일로 구성된 비밀번호 작성 요구 사항"과 "주기적인 비밀번호 변경 요구 사항"을 "금지"할 예정. 이는 사이버 보안 약점으로 간주됨

AWS 블록 스토리지 진화
- EBS개발팀 HDD를 SSD로 교체만으로 문제 해결로 생각, 기대만큼 개선되지 않아 네트워크와 S/W에 주목
- 가상화와 Nitro(전용 하드웨어)를 개발로 속도 개선
- TCP 대신 SRD개발로 네트워크 오버헤드 줄임
- EBS 레이턴시 1밀리초 미만으로 줄임
